Get Pre-Approved (Not to be confused with getting "pre-qualified".)

Pre-qualified is simply based on the verbal information given to the lender. Pre-approval is based on the lender doing a thorough search into your credit report and your household income. The lender will then notify you of your maximum amount of mortgage they will offer you. With pre-approval you can look for a home with confidence knowing your buying power.

Compare lenders' rates and charges. More than simply comparing interest rates, also ask about discount and/or origination points, application fees, appraisal fees and any other closing and service fees charged by the lender.
